Kevin is creating a target for a game that will be played at the schools carnival. In order to do this kevin needs to put red tape in the shape of an x as shown below. If the area of the sqaure board is 25 square feet how many feet of tape will he need?

Answer:

Kevin need 14.14 feet of red tape

Explanation:

Given: (Figure Attached)

Area of Square = 25 square feet

As we know

Area of square = length x width = a x a = 25

a * a = 25

a = ±5 by taking square root both sides

It means a = 5 as the length can not be negative

Now we know the length of sides of square and as shown in figure we can break the figure in two triangles,

By using Pythagoras theorem on one triangle we will find the length of one line of x and then multiply the x with 2 to get the overall feet of tape.


Hypotenuse^(2) =
Base^(2) + Perpendicular^(2)


Hypotenuse^(2) =
x^(2) = 5^(2) + 5^(2)


x^(2) = 50

x = ± 7.07 It means x = 7.07

Now the total tape required is 2 * x = 2*7.07 = 14.14
